pub struct FloatingTabThemePartial {
pub background: Option<Preference<Color>>,
pub hover_background: Option<Preference<Color>>,
pub width: Option<Preference<Size>>,
pub height: Option<Preference<Size>>,
pub padding: Option<Preference<Gaps>>,
pub color: Option<Preference<Color>>,
}Expand description
You can use this to change a theme for only one component, with the theme property.
